Zambian president surges ahead in vote
Oct 1 2006 7:45PM (CT)
LUSAKA, Zambia (AP) - Zambia's president, whose policies have helped boost economic growth in the southern African country, consolidated his lead Sunday in the election vote count, as police used tear gas against rioters who stormed an election center to protest the results.

EC head urges Sudan to keep Darfur peace
Oct 1 2006 4:22PM (CT)
EL FASHER, Sudan (AP) - The head of the European Commission urged Sudan's president on Sunday to help the African Union keep peace in the troubled Darfur region and end the obstacles hampering the work of humanitarian groups there.

Nigerian dam collapse kills up to 40
Oct 1 2006 2:46PM (CT)
KANO, Nigeria (AP) - Families were swept away in a torrent of water and up to 40 people were feared dead after a dam collapsed in northwest Nigeria, a state-owned radio station said Sunday.
